A clear path from idea to launch.
Every project moves through the same seven stages, so you always know what's happening, what comes next, and what it costs.
Discovery
We learn what the business needs, who the users are, what problem must be solved, and how success will be measured.
Definition
We establish the approved scope, user roles, workflows, integrations, assumptions, exclusions, timeline, and pricing.
Design
We create the user flows and interface designs needed to confirm how the product should work before full development.
Development
We build the approved features using the technology selected for the project.
Testing
We test the defined workflows, permissions, devices, integrations, and major error states.
Launch
We prepare the approved product for deployment, production use, or app-store submission.
Support and Growth
After launch, clients may select maintenance, improvement, or ongoing product-development support.
